What deliverability scores actually measure (and what they don’t)
Deliverability scores assess technical health: sender reputation, blacklisting status, SPF/DKIM/DMARC alignment, IP warm-up, and historical engagement. They reflect system-level trustworthiness, not content quality, subject line strength, or timing—factors that influence inbox placement but aren’t quantified in the score. A high score means your emails can reach inboxes, but not that they’ll be opened or clicked. Think of it as the engine running well—not whether the driver knows where they’re going.
What deliverability scores actually measure
These scores are built on infrastructure and reputation. They track whether your domain has valid authentication (SPF, DKIM, DMARC), if your sending IP is on any blocklists, and how often your past emails have been marked as spam or bounced. They also consider engagement trends—like open and click rates over time—because consistent low engagement harms sender reputation, even if the email technically delivered.
For example, if your IP was used in a previous spam campaign, even with strong authentication, it could still carry a negative score. Conversely, a fresh IP with clean setup and high engagement will gradually build a better score. The RFC 7801 outline on email authentication and deliverability highlights that technical alignment is foundational, but not sufficient on its own.
What deliverability scores don’t measure
They don’t reflect how compelling your subject line is, whether your content resonates, or if you’re sending at the best time for your audience. That’s where real customer data comes in. A high deliverability score won’t prevent an email from being ignored—especially if it’s sent to a disengaged list, poorly segmented, or full of generic messaging.
Let’s say you’re sending a newsletter with strong authentication. Your score is 94. That means the server accepts your email. But if the email goes to someone who hasn’t opened in 18 months, it may still land in the spam folder or be ignored. That gap between delivery and engagement is where combining deliverability scores with real customer behavior shines.
You need both. Use deliverability scores to fix the technical foundation—clean up invalid addresses, verify domains, ensure proper authentication. Then layer in customer data: past opens, clicks, product usage, or time-zone preferences to fine-tune when and how you send.
For example, use bulk verification to prune invalid addresses before sending, and pair that with behavioral data to target only active subscribers. That way, your high score doesn’t just get emails to inboxes—it gets them noticed.

How to merge deliverability scores with original customer data
You can combine email deliverability scores with your customer data by verifying your list with a tool like Emaillistchecker.io to get real-time scores (0–100) and verdicts for each address, then joining that data with your CRM or analytics system using email as the key. Once joined, you can assess risk by segment—like high-value or inactive customers—and take action, such as suppressing low-scoring, high-intent addresses before sending.
Step-by-step integration process
- Run your list through an email-verification SaaS like bulk verification to generate deliverability scores and verification verdicts. This checks for syntax, domain validity, inbox existence, and catch-all detection in real time.
- Export the results with the email address, deliverability score (0–100), and a clear verdict—valid, catch-all, risky, or invalid. This is your deliverability layer, ready for analysis.
- Use email as the join key to merge this data with your CRM (HubSpot, Salesforce) or analytics platform (Looker, Snowflake). This sync ensures every contact has a deliverability score tied to their history, engagement, and value.
- Map deliverability risk to existing customer segments. For example, check how many new leads in your top sales funnel have scores below 70. Compare that with inactive subscribers—you may find older, low-engagement accounts with high risk scores due to stale data.
- Flag low-scoring emails in high-intent or high-value segments. If a high-value customer has a score below 50, suppress them from your next campaign. Sending to such addresses harms sender reputation—a risk that compounds over time, as shown by Spamhaus, which tracks reputation-based filtering.

When to act on low deliverability scores
If an email address has a deliverability score below 60, especially in high-value or high-intent segments, you should not send to it. A low score signals a high risk of bounce, spam filtering, or inbox placement failure. Use real-time score drops to flag sudden drops in sender reputation—this could indicate a compromised IP or a surge in spam complaints. Apply clear sending rules based on score ranges: act immediately on 0–69, monitor 70–89, and send confidently on 90–100.
Take action based on score thresholds
- Never send to any high-intent or high-value customer with a deliverability score below 60. These accounts should be re-verified or excluded entirely. Sending to them wastes resources and risks harming your sender reputation.
- Monitor for real-time score drops — especially sudden declines from 85 to 45 in a single day. Such shifts often point to a compromised IP, a spike in spam complaints, or a misconfigured authentication setup. Check sender reputation tools like Spamhaus to validate.
- Set automated rules by score range:
- 90–100: Deliverability is strong. Send with no restrictions.
- 70–89: Proceed with caution. Use a warm-up strategy or limit send volume.
- 0–69: Block all sends. Investigate the address or remove it from your list unless you’re confident in re-verification.
- Use your email verifier’s API to continuously recheck your list after score shifts. This ensures you’re not acting on outdated intelligence. Integrations with platforms like Mailchimp or HubSpot make automated pruning easier.

Identify systematic issues before they escalate
Don’t just check deliverability scores in isolation. Plot them weekly or monthly for each customer segment—like high-income users, repeat buyers, or regional groups. A gradual decline across all segments suggests a systemic problem, such as a compromised sending IP or a misconfigured authentication setup. Conversely, dropping scores only in one segment may point to content or timing issues.
Use tools that track both delivery and inbox placement—such as inbox placement testing—because a message might technically "deliver" but still end up in spam folders. According to an Return Path report, even small drops in inbox placement can cut engagement by 20% or more over time. This is why real-time insights matter.
Correlate trends with operational changes
When deliverability dips, ask: did you send more emails last week? Did your list grow fast without verification? Was there a new sending IP or domain added to your workflow? These are common triggers. Monitoring score trends alongside campaign volume, list growth rate, and IP changes helps isolate real root causes.
For example, a sudden spike in bounces after a list import may not be spam traps—it could be outdated or invalid addresses. Running a bulk verification process like email list validation before sending confirms which addresses are active and which could harm your reputation. The same applies to new domains: always test authentication (SPF, DKIM, DMARC) before using them at scale.
